Frequently Asked Questions about Bloomington
How much are Studio apartments in Bloomington?
There are currently 147 Studio Apartments in Bloomington with rent ranges from $783 to $2,205 with an average price of $1,427.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Bloomington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Bloomington ranges from $945 to $4,203 with an average monthly rent of $1,539.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Bloomington c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Bloomington range from $1,066 to $5,500.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,950.
How expensive are Bloomington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 104 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Bloomington on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,511 to $11,414 - averaging $2,415 for the location.
